    New ST-210 double mug press

    Signzworld promoting new double mug press which looks interesting especially for saving some desk space doing large press runs.

    Anyone bought and used please and can give us a review?

    I got one when they first came out. I'm not anti signzworld like a lot of people. I've found their service to be good and their budget presses and mugs really good for the money. I was a bit disappointed by this twin press though which I bought for a friend to do a bit of overspill work for me. It looks like the body is cast aluminium. Its plastic sprayed silver. That means the whole thing bends when pressure is applied. And you need a lot of pressure because the blankets are rock solid. OK if you are doing a simple logo on the side but my designs aren't like that. A good buy for a double press I guess but not heavy duty at all. Hope that helps!
